IMPALA-4400: aggregate runtime filters locally

Move RuntimeFilterBank to QueryState(). Implement fine-grained
locking for each filter to mitigate any increased lock
contention from the change.

Make RuntimeFilterBank handle multiple producers of the
same filter, e.g. multiple instances of a partitioned
join. It computes the expected number of filters upfront
then sends the filter to the coordinator once all the
local instances have been merged together. The merging
can be done in parallel locally to improve latency of
filter propagation.

Add Or() methods to MinMaxFilter and BloomFilter, since
we now need to merge those, not just the thrift versions.

Update coordinator filter routing to expect only one
instance of a filter from each producer backend and
to only send one instance to each consumer backend
(instead of sending one per fragment).

Update memory reservations and estimates to be lower
to account for sharing of filters between fragment
instances. mt_dop plans are modified to show these
shared and non-shared resources separately.

Enable waiting for runtime filters for kudu scanner
with mt_dop.

Made min/max filters const-correct.

Testing
* Added unit tests for Or() methods.
* Added some additional e2e test coverage for mt_dop queries
* Updated planner tests with new estimates and reservation.
* Ran a single node 3-impalad stress test with TPC-H kudu and
  TPC-DS parquet.
* Ran exhaustive tests.
* Ran core tests with ASAN.

Perf
* Did a single-node perf run on TPC-H with default settings. No perf change.
* Single-node perf run with mt_dop=8 showed significant speedups:

> Aggregate runtime filters locally
> ---------------------------------

> At the moment, runtime filters are sent from each fragment instance directly 
> to the coordinator for aggregation (ORing) at the coordinator.
> With multi-threaded execution, we will have an order of magnitude more 
> fragment instances per node, at which point the coordinator would become a 
> bottleneck during the aggregation process. To avoid that, we need to 
> aggregate the local instances' runtime filters at each node before sending 
> the filter off to the coordinator.
